Stranded in Armenia, 4 Indians reach Delhi

NEW DELHI: Four people from Punjab who were duped by a travel agent and got stranded in Armenia during December 2018 reached the national capital on Saturday.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) Punjab president Bhagwant Mann had intervened to ensure their return. He received them at Delhi airport after their return. “Four people who were stuck in Armenia have reached Delhi today. I thank the Ministry of External Affairs and Sushma ji who worked hard. The Indian embassy took care of them, and provided food and tickets,” said Sangrur MP Bhagwant Mann.
